
Staff Software Engineer – Multiple Squads
Dasa
full-time
Posted on:
Location Type: Hybrid
Location: São Paulo • Brazil
Visit company websiteExplore more
Job Level
Tech Stack
About the role
- Technical Leadership: Serve as the technical reference for engineering and product management, translating complex business requirements into the design of distributed, resilient systems
- Architecture and Design: Design solutions for high concurrency and low latency. Define API standards, data modeling and integration strategies (synchronous/asynchronous)
- Operational Excellence: Raise the bar for quality (automated testing, observability, CI/CD). Ensure systems meet non-functional requirements (SLA, 99.99% availability, security)
- Mentorship: Develop Senior engineers and Tech Leads through critical code reviews and pairing on difficult "wicked problems"
- Modernization: Lead strangler-fig initiatives to migrate legacy systems or monoliths to microservices without disrupting Dasa's operations
- Interoperability: Design and maintain complex integrations between hospitals', laboratories' legacy systems and our platform, ensuring data fidelity
- Engineering Culture: Foster communities of practice (Guilds), promote technology events and elevate the company's technical employer brand
- Cross-Domain Problem Solving: Act as an internal consultant to resolve critical architectural bottlenecks that prevent business scaling (e.g., bottlenecks in medical report generation/visualization)
Requirements
- Experience: Proven track record of technical leadership on mission-critical systems
- Tech Stack: Java/Kotlin, NodeJS, React, Cloud (GCP – plus), AWS, Azure, Kubernetes, Kafka/RabbitMQ, Relational databases (Postgres/Oracle/SQL Server) and NoSQL (MongoDB), Event-driven architectures
- Security and Privacy: Solid knowledge of LGPD, protection of Sensitive Personal Data (PII/PHI) and Secure-by-Design principles
- Leadership by Influence: Ability to navigate technical, clinical and business teams, aligning conflicting expectations
- Differentials: Ability to operate in ambiguous environments and influence teams without direct authority; experience with complex scheduling systems; knowledge of architectures for diagnostic AI or Clinical Decision Support Systems (CDSS)
Benefits
- Food: Meal voucher / food allowance or on-site cafeteria (depending on location)
- Health: Health insurance and life insurance
- Professional Development: Dasa University, Development and Career Cycle, Technology/PMAX academies and the Crescer (Grow) program within Dasa
- Other: Transportation voucher and performance-based bonus (PPR)
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
JavaKotlinNodeJSReactGCPAWSAzureKubernetesKafkaRabbitMQ
Soft Skills
technical leadershipmentorshipcross-domain problem solvingleadership by influenceoperating in ambiguous environments